Dolphin's Do Poem by David Darbyshire

Dolphin's Do

Rating: 5.0


Dolphins do love to perform
then they instantly transform
into little pups, playing
beautifully, quietly, freely
calmly, sedately, peacefully
in the deep green sea

They are unafraid, fearless
in their activities
investigating all environments
either playing or hunting
in their love tub, The Ocean

Their long nose gets everywhere
Sonar picks up all movement
like a fishing boat, or 'Troller Nets'
floating garbage, oil slicks,
all not fun when all you want to do is Play?

I am sure it will change one Day soon
before all the dolphins are gone, this afternoon
My dream would be: to splash and play
with the pretty lovely Dolphins, all Day

Dolphin's Do talk
And their very smart
They can't walk
But soon they may,
have to start..........: -(
